- Review 122 (rev-security-02) found expected_names | grep -Fxq could falsely reject valid markers under pipefail when grep closed the pipe after an early match and the producer exited 141.
|
||||
- Independent canonical-Alpine live-manifest stress reproduced intermittent false failures at the current four-arm set size. No small-manifest safe threshold is claimed.
|
||||
|
||||
DETERMINISTIC RED
|
||||
- The focused suite now generates a 20,001-name manifest with a valid target sorted first and invokes the real mark path.
|
||||
- Before remediation, in canonical Alpine ci-base:
|
||||
docker run --rm -u "$(id -u):$(id -g)" -v "$PWD:/workspace" -w /workspace git.mosaicstack.dev/mosaicstack/stack/ci-base:latest bash tools/verify-greenfield-execution-coverage.test.sh
|
||||
=> canonical_sigpipe_tdd_red_rc=1
|
||||
=> [fixture-suite] case is not in the expected set: a-target
|
||||
- This control exercises the production checker invocation rather than an approximated producer and makes the early-close race deterministic by exceeding pipe capacity.
|
||||
|
||||
IMPLEMENTATION
|
||||
- The mark path now fully materializes expected_names into expected_snapshot and fails closed if production fails.
|
||||
- grep -Fxq reads the completed snapshot through a here-string; there is no producer/consumer pipeline to close early.
|
||||
- Missing names still fail with the same attributable message. No `|| true` or other failure suppression was introduced.
|
||||
- Exact-set checks, marker inventory, aggregation, archive binding, fixture dispositions, expected-RED manifest, e2e installer, #869 wiring, and acquisition behavior are unchanged.

## Round 8 — pipefail-safe expected-set membership
|
||||
|
||||
- Review 122 found `expected_names | grep -Fxq` could falsely reject a valid early-sorted marker: `grep -q` closes after its match, the upstream sorter can exit 141, and `pipefail` selects that producer failure. Independent canonical-Alpine stress measured failures at the live four-arm manifest size, so no safe small-set threshold is claimed.
|
||||
- A deterministic 20,001-entry real-script mark control makes the unfixed canonical-Alpine path RED with `case is not in the expected set: a-target`. The mark path now materializes and validates the complete expected-name snapshot before applying `grep -q` via a here-string, eliminating the producer/consumer pipe while retaining fail-closed producer errors.
|
||||
- The focused suite is green locally and in canonical Alpine after remediation. A separate 1,000-mark canonical-Alpine stress against the live four-arm production manifest recorded zero false failures.
|
||||
- Final review: Codex code APPROVE confidence 0.96 and security risk NONE confidence 0.98, both with zero findings. Full installer tests, typecheck 45/45, lint 25/25, format, Bash syntax, ShellCheck, Woodpecker strict lint, canonical deterministic/stress controls, retained Round-6 mutants, and diff check pass with 11G free.
|
||||
- Full evidence: `docs/reports/verification/1050-c1-fix-round/14-round8-pipefail-membership.txt`.
